How Time Off Works In the Time & Attendance Edition, you can track the time off owed to and taken by users. Web TimeSheet provides these features: Automatic accruals and resets Time off bookings Time off entry on the timesheet Automatic Accruals and Resets Web TimeSheet can be used to track the amount of time off employees earn, as follows: 1.    You define a number of types of time off, to categorize the time off taken by users. 2.    You set accrual and reset policies for each time off type, for each user. 3.    The user’s balance is automatically adjusted based on the accrual and reset policies. Booking Time Off For time off requiring advance approval, Web TimeSheet allows users to book time off, as follows: 1.    A user requests time off by submitting a time off booking, with the appropriate time off type selected. 2.    Once the booking is submitted: The user’s balance is reduced by the amount of time off requested. The booking is automatically sent to one or more approvers. The booking is displayed in the user’s time off calendar. 3.    The approvers approve the booking. Offline timesheets and offline expense sheets have the following constraints: The client machine must have a local e-mail client installed. The e-mail client must allow for sending/receiving attachments. They are only supported by the Microsoft Internet Explorer browser, version 6.0 or higher. If using Microsoft Outlook, the Mail Format must be set to Plain Text (not HTML). The Time off in Lieu time off type cannot accrue time.
